Yes, we are a crowd.

It seems it was yesterday, but it has been more than 12 years since that epic text* that shook european disobedience movement was written, short before Geneva Summit

"They say that they are new, they christen themselves by acronyms: G8, IMF, WB, WTO, NAFTA, FTAA… They cannot fool us, they are the same as those who have come before them: (...) the old world that

stopped our assaults and destroyed all stairways to heaven.

Nowadays they have a new empire, they impose new servitudes on the whole globe, they still play the lords and masters of the land and the sea. Once again, we the multitudes rise up against them."

Yes, we are a crowd. Javier Ochoa has his mind clear and his rethorical questions quickly finds the answer in this track, full of consciousness, pride and (re)assertion

Yes, we are a crowd. We are no longer doubtful. That is what we are: little, young and old, fighting for our rights, armed with our words and bodies.

And our music: derlivered once again by Bass CUlture Players, this time under the Back-A-Yard label. This deep and solid riddm seems tailor-made for the message and vocals of Javier Ochoa.

Puppashan complets the work with a penetrating dub splattered with sparks.

And judging by its latest releases, anyone could think that Discoinferno holds on to our time's pulse. Our time, where doubts, fears and questions transform into affirmation:

Yes, we are a crowd.

___

* From The Multitudes Of Europe Rising Up Against The Empire.

Wu Ming, Springtime 2001.

Bass Culture Players Madrid, Spain

Bass Culture Players is a roots music project settled in Madrid (Spain). Puppa Shan leads this approach to the different music styles and culture rooted and developed in Jamaica and U.K. during the 70´s and 80´s.

Discoinferno Studio is where music production takes place, using analogical equipment and traditional techniques.
